Skip to Main Content
백서

IC 검증용 프로덕션 레디 엔지니어링 솔루션에 머신 러닝(ML) 방식 사용

ML을 활용해 SPICE 수준 IC 검증에 일관성 있고 검증 가능하며 올바른 답을 도출하는 법

Solido Variation Designer에 포함된 Solido High-Sigma Verifier는 ML 기반 솔루션으로 4, 5, 6 이상의 시그마에서 정확한 전체 탐색 방식 수준의 검증 결과를 제공하며, 시뮬레이션 런타임은 몇 배나 짧습니다. High-Sigma Verifier를 이용하면 설계팀과 검증팀이 검증 정확도와 커버리지는 늘리면서도 설계 일정은 대폭 단축할 수 있습니다. High-Sigma Verifier는 레벨 3 ML 알고리즘 설계의 좋은 예이며, 대규모 프로덕션 사용 반복 개선을 통해 레벨 4에 급속히 가까워지고 있습니다.

Solido 머신 러닝: 레벨 4 ML 기능 지향

Siemens EDA의 Solido™ 소프트웨어는 레벨 4 ML 기능에 가까운 ML 툴을 개발했습니다. Solido 툴에서는 첫 단계로 DoE (Design of Experiments)를 수행합니다. 이는 결과 공간 전체를 아우르는 일련의 측정치를 낮은 밀도로 모은 것입니다.

DoE 결과를 바탕으로 예상되는 결과의 ML 모델을 1차적으로 구성할 수 있습니다. 모델 정확도가 더 높아야 하는 경우, 목표 관심 분야를 파악합니다. 그런 다음 툴이 더 많은 결과를 도출하고, 이를 ML이 생성한 결과와 비교합니다. 결과가 엔지니어링 허용오차 이내로 일치하지 않으면 툴은 더 많은 데이터와 업데이트한 모델을 사용해 추가로 최적화를 수행합니다. Solido 툴은 이 프로세스를 거쳐 폭넓은 결과를 확보할 수 있으며, 기본 내장 검증은 물론 관심 분야에 맞춰 미세 조정된 결과에 관한 세분성까지 추가로 보장할 수 있습니다

공유